Wabtec
Everywhere
yesterday
Tours, France, FR
Derby, United Kingdom, GB
Berwick, PA, US
Contagem, Brazil, BR
Yankton - Sd - Usa (w City Limits Rd), US
Marhowra, India, IN
Wroclaw, Poland, PL
Results 1 - 10 of 666 1234656 more jobs »